Round: HR Interview
Experience: - Choose between Mahatma Gandhi and Subhash Chandra Bose. I personally, would advise you to go for Mahatma Gandhi. If you go for Bose, they will reject you saying that you have a violent side to your personality which of course is not good for them.- What would you do if you were given 1 lakh and were told to jump off the first floor? 5 lakh for the 2nd floor? 10 for the 3rd floor?
Assess the risk in every situation and then using your reasoning, give the answer. I answered that for the amount of money involved i would jump off the 1st and 2nd floors but not the 3rd floor. At maximum I would break my bones or suffer a few fractures which is good enough for the money.
-I give you 5 lakhs right now. Go and kiss the girl standing outside. Will you take the risk?
I said yes I will. She will slap me on the face or maybe get a complaint registered against me with the Dean. It will be a fair deal for the money involved.
-I said, “Sir, my height is about 6 feet. So if I lie down 3 times along the length that should be enough reason for you to get convinced”. So I lied down on the floor along the length of the room thrice.The HR interview was a very different experience for me. I felt that they were looking for a guy who would fit best in their culture and has the ability not only to take risks but also assess it and mitigate it. Besides this they also asked me some HR questions like why should we hire you, what are your goals and why are you suitable for the company. There were few other HR questions as well which were not so different form the regular ones.Overall it was a very good interview experience. They were looking for people who can take risks and were not hesitant to take an initiative and then back their decision with sound thought process.
